(Ordem Militar de Sant'Iago da Espada). Instituted 1175. Type III. 1918-Present. A well executed enamelled Collar in silver gilt, consisting of a chain composed of 12 detailed red, green, and white enamelled links alternating with 12 delicate green and blue enamelled bow-tied laurel wreath links, including hook-backed clasp at the neck joining the two ends together with makers mark of J.A. DA COSTA LISBOA, reverse of all other links are plain, measuring 76.0 cm in length, near extremely fine. Accompanied by the badge of the collar, consisting of a finely enamelled red St. James cross surrounded by an enamelled light green palm wreath featuring a white enamelled ribbon depicting the inscription SCIENCIAS, LETRAS E ARTES (Science, Literature, and Arts), suspended by enamelled dark green and blue laurel wreath, measuring 51.2mm (w) x 101.1mm (h – inclusive of wreath suspension), light enamel wear to the badge, both the collar and badge weigh 162.4 grams, a lovely collar and badge set, in extremely fine condition.
